Well, it is advisable for you not to disturb a new hamster. Let it be by itself for 2 days. Do not kacau it. Let it rest and get used to new environment lah.
No, the bite is not painful... maybe it would feel pain to you but it will not cause a wound or draw blood lah. Most small animals bite, so you should never be scared of this. If you are, then should have thought about other pets. Basically, anything with a mouth and teeth will bite if they feel there is a need to do so. |

He is better off alone lah.... if you get another, there is a possibility he will fight and you won't wanna see any hamster get in fights... sometimes a few wounds and scratches but some can get terribly bloody.
Your hamster would be happier alone. They will always sleep during the day, only active quite late at night or early mornings to explore and run around. Being a hamster owner, you should interact and handle him to avoid boredom. |

there's a difference between BITE and NIBBLE.
for mine, the female is the heavy nibbler, sometimes turn to biting. not out of aggression or anything though, she just likes to sink her teeth (hard) into any thing she comes by. they don't give bleeding bites la, once they start to nibble you just move your fingers away. |
